Output 53f24ed8a4a065d6ade2f95b81ebc46692825ad20a139b91d62365f76d990e17:1

value
1035562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53eb21da59e3f1ca5c90717f977c726fee79ef29 OP_EQUAL
address
39LjgjsaEaJA45VFMCqXxeyF5XFRV29gFT
transaction
53f24ed8a4a065d6ade2f95b81ebc46692825ad20a139b91d62365f76d990e17
spent
true